Marina Romea weather in January (Emilia-Romagna, Italy)
How is the weather in Marina Romea in January? Check out this comprehensive weather guide.
In January, Marina Romea generally has low temperatures and moderate rainfall. January is a winter month. Daytime temperatures hover around 10°C, while nights can cool down to about 4°C. During this period, the city experiences its coolest temperatures annually.
Marina Romea in January usually receives moderate rainfall, averaging around 50 mm for the month. Typically around 11 days of rainfall is expected.
The city usually sees around 67 hours of sunlight, indicating fewer sunny days.
If you're looking for dry conditions and comfortable temperatures, January may not be the ideal month to visit Marina Romea. May, June, September and October typically offer the best circumstances. While January tends to showcase less optimal conditions.
